I have uninstalled windows messanger.  I have taken it off
of the start menu. Whenever I start outlook express I get
a message saying a newer version of Windows messanger is
available do I want to install.  I want to stop these
messages
Jonathan Kay [MVP] - 29 Feb 2004 01:02 GMT
Greetings Larry,

To stop this, close Outlook Express, then download and run this .reg file:
http://messenger.jonathankay.com/downloads/stopmessenger_oe.reg

After this, Outlook Express will no longer load Messenger and therefore you won't see this
message.
